Trimbach’s Pinot Noir Réserve is a reminder that Alsace isn’t just about whites. Sourced from estate vineyards and crafted with typical precision, it’s a vibrant, finely etched red with purity, poise and just the right amount of grip. Bright cherry fruit, subtle spice and a whisper of earthiness—proof that Pinot Noir from Alsace deserves a spot on the serious wine drinker’s radar.
Winemaker's Notes
Grapes are selected at maturity and after de-stemming, they undergo a gentle pneumatic pressing followed by an eight-day cold maceration to extract color and fruit. The juices are blended in the cellar in stainless steel vats and old casks for the malolactic fermentation. The Pinot Noirs are the only Trimbach wines which undergo malolactic fermentation (in tank); No long ageing on lees. They are bottled after three months ageing in stainless steel tanks.
Delicate aromas red and black berries underlined by subtle smoky and forest floor. Beautifully structured mouthfeel, combines fruitiness – Morello cherries and kirsch – with supple, velvety tannins and juicy freshness.
